Toyland Store locator Ontario

Toyland stores located in Ontario: 2
Largest shopping mall with Toyland store in Ontario: Woodbine Shopping Centre, Fantasy Fair 

Toyland store locator Ontario displays complete list and huge database of Toyland stores, factory stores, shops and boutiques in Ontario. Toyland information: map of Ontario, shopping hours, contact information.

Search all Toyland stores located in Ontario

Specify Toyland store location:

Go to the city Toyland locator